Output 6ac39cd1e746c0b3f3404cd83f82cfee24ad206daf12ec8a3aec3fda0b6706a6:0

value
990584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e6c7c64688d5143a90c582b2f9fc29f9c011d04 OP_EQUAL
address
3Eg5qWvFFjCiVd3162it6YJL1pXoWyFeQ1
transaction
6ac39cd1e746c0b3f3404cd83f82cfee24ad206daf12ec8a3aec3fda0b6706a6
spent
true